Originally posted by sweetsc400
Would that not add quite a bit of weight?
It wouldn't add any weight because the the chrome is actually paint..Believe it or not that is a paint that shines like chrome but maintains and is applied like just like paint..It is very pricey also, $1200 a pint.. and that is at cost..And you still need a special clear to adhere to it which is also pricey.
